Admission Details
Merit in qualifying examination, subject to fulfilling eligibility criteria.
Admission is based on:
Eligibility Criteria
Pass with 55% aggregate marks in Bachelor’s degree (any discipline) or equivalent, subject to qualifying
1. LPUNEST* or CAT or MAT or XAT or NMAT or CMAT
2. Video Essay
3. Interview
Or
Completed Company Secretary (CS) from Institute of Company Secretaries of India (ICSI), subject to qualifying Video Essay and Interview
Or
Completed Chartered Accountancy (CA) from Institute of Chartered Accountants of India (ICAI), subject to qualifying Video Essay and Interview
Or
Completed Cost & Management Accountancy (CMA) from Institute of Cost Accountants of India (ICAI)., subject to qualifying Video Essay and Interview
Click here to view the Detailed Guidelines for Video Essay and Interview.
(5% relaxation to North-East states and Sikkim candidates or Defence Personnel and their Dependents or Wards of Kashmiri Migrants)
*The LPUNEST exam offers convenient choices to candidates: Online remotely proctored from Home (recommended by the university, based on available resources) or Test centre-based options.
For NS (Non Sponsored) category - min. 50% marks in Graduation with min score of MAT - 500/GMAT – 500 / CMAT - 150 Or percentile in CAT/XAT - 75 / NMAT - 60 Or Amity Written Test on the day of Interview.
For S (Sponsored) category - min. 50% marks in Graduation with min score of MAT-450/GMAT- 450/ CMAT - 100 Or percentile in CAT/XAT - 65 / NMAT - 50 Or Amity Written Test on the day of Interview.
